2012 • Sophomore
Turned in one of the best sophomore seasons in SLU history on the hill...went 7-2 with a team-best 2.62 ERA, a mark that is the ninth-best single season ERA in SLU history and the best ever by a Billiken sophomore...did not allow a home run in 96 innings pitched...threw a complete game shutout in the A-10 tournament, holding Saint Joseph's to three hits while striking out four and walking two...

2011 · Freshman
Made 13 appearances out of the bullpen in his first season...struck out 22 batters while only allowing nine free passes...opened the season with 4.0 innings of scoreless baseball...ended season in a similar fashion, with 4.1 innings of blank slate...against Southern Illinois, threw 2.0 innings of shutout relief, notching four strikeouts with no walks and only two hits...

At Park Hill
Was a first-team All-Suburban Big Six selection as a senior ... helped the Trojans to conference, district and sectional titles ... played on the National Baseball Congress U18 national championship team playing on the Barnstormers Baseball Club in Kansas City ... also ran four seasons of cross country.
